**Legion (2010)** Legion (2010) plunges viewers into a world where God has lost faith in humankind, unleashing his legion of angels to instigate the Apocalypse. The last flicker of hope for humanity rests with a disparate group of strangers who find themselves trapped in an isolated, out-of-the-way desert diner. Their unlikely protector is none other than the Archangel Michael, who defies his divine brethren to stand with humanity, preparing for a desperate last stand against the overwhelming celestial forces intent on erasing mankind. The film is a thrilling siege narrative, blending supernatural horror with intense action as the small band of survivors fights for a future they barely dare to imagine. While Scott Stewart's filmography often divides critics, *Legion* stands out as a quintessential entry on any "Best Scott Stewart Movies" list because it powerfully establishes his signature blend of gritty supernatural action and apocalyptic imagery. As his feature directorial debut, it showcased his distinctive visual style, bringing to life striking creature designs and impactful action sequences within the tense, confined setting of the diner. The film not only delivered a compelling, albeit polarizing, vision of the End Times but also proved a solid commercial success, cementing Stewart's presence in the genre landscape and laying the groundwork for his subsequent projects like *Priest*. It remains arguably his most definitive and recognized work, embodying the bold thematic ambitions and visual flair that characterize his directorial efforts.
